The enigma of the heraldic shield and its relationship with the surname Catelain

The symbiosis between the heraldic shield and Catelain is a fascinating and convoluted mystery. In the beginning, coats of arms were awarded to specific individuals, not entire families, and were linked to the person who received them for their exploits, combat, or social status. As time went by, the Catelain shield emblem became hereditary, becoming a recognizable emblem that identifies the family lineage, thus establishing an unbreakable connection with the Catelain surname.

Fundamental points regarding the connection between the family coat of arms and the surname Catelain

Line of succession: Although the coat of arms could be associated with Catelain, it is essential to note that they were traditionally granted to specific individuals. This implies that not all individuals with the surname Catelain have a hereditary right to the shield linked to Catelain, especially if they fail to prove a direct relationship with the original bearer of the shield. Likewise, it is likely to find different shields for the surname Catelain, since they could have been granted to members of different lineages but with the surname Catelain.

Variations: Within a family that bears the surname Catelain, it is common to find different versions of the heraldic shield, which can serve to distinguish between different family branches, historical eras or even noble titles. specific.
